Steve Bannon Predicts Cabinet Role for Youngest-Ever White House Press Secretary

Karoline Leavitt, 27, reportedly questions her readiness for top roles as Bannon forecasts her rapid political ascent.

Overview

  • Steve Bannon has predicted that Karoline Leavitt, the 27-year-old White House Press Secretary, could be elevated to a Cabinet position or even Chief of Staff within the next two years.
  • Leavitt, the youngest person to ever hold the press secretary role, reportedly doubts her qualifications for such high-level positions, according to sources familiar with her thinking.
  • Bannon, who supported Leavitt early in her career, highlighted her willingness to champion Trump’s election fraud claims as a defining trait of her alignment with the MAGA movement.
  • Leavitt’s rapid rise from a failed 2022 congressional campaign in New Hampshire to a central figure in Trump’s media strategy reflects her generational approach to political communication.
  • President Trump has voiced strong support for Leavitt, framing her as a loyal ally and suggesting her 2022 electoral loss was a benefit to his administration.
